Some of their most internationally successful TV series such as “The Untamed” (and its animation) are adapted from such fictions.
Largely faithful to plot but by removing certain scenes and converting undertones to “brotherhood”.
I haven’t read it myself and I can’t evaluate how it portrays same-sex relations since I am straight myself, but based on what I know, the most popular translated danmei are “Heaven Official’s blessing” and “The Founder of Diabolism” (source of the untamed).
If anyone is interested, they can try them.
